The San Pz Piranha is on the Radschützenpanzer mowag piranha built ambulance , which in since 2008. Swiss Army is in use.
Characteristics
The tank is unarmed, it is only equipped with a smoke throw system. It is built on the six-wheeled piranha armored personnel carrier.
The four-man crew consists of a driver, a commander, a doctor and a unit paramedic . The doctor and the paramedic are responsible for the patients in the rear part of the vehicle and the driver and the commander are responsible for the vehicle. The driver and the commander are also trained as unit paramedics. In order to receive training on this vehicle, you have to be drafted as a unit medic / tank driver.
Patient care is possible in the following constellations: 1–3 patients lying down / 2 patients lying down and 3 sitting / 6 patients sitting. The medical equipment is equivalent to a civilian ambulance.
Due to its light armor, the lack of armament and the medical service role, the medical tank cannot engage in combat with battle tanks . The operational doctrine stipulates that wounded soldiers should be transported from the battlefield as quickly as possible and with the least possible danger. After the patient has been rescued, the vehicle should then withdraw immediately, throwing smoke.
The Federal Department of Defense has the vehicle under the type license no. 40-0000 307, data sheet no. / Code: 35'046, designation: San Pz 6x6 gl Piranha.
